11.2 Reading out/saving service data
Procedure via the SIMATIC memory card
If it is no longer possible for technical reasons to communicate with the CPU via Ethernet,
you can also read out the service data via the SIMATIC memory card. To do this, proceed as
follows:
1. Insert the SIMATIC memory card into the card reader of your PC / programming device.
2. Open the job file S7_JOB.S7S in an editor.
3. Overwrite the entry PROGRAM with the string DUMP in the editor.
(Do not use any spaces/line breaks/quotation marks to ensure that the file size is exactly
4 bytes)
4. Save the file under the existing file name.
5. Make sure that the SIMATIC Memory Card is not write protected and insert it in the slot
on the CPU.
(for the CPU 1518-4 PN/DP, you need a card ≥ 2 GB and for the CPU 1511-1 PN,
CPU 1513-1 PN, CPU 1515-2 PN, and CPU 1516-3 PN/DP a card ≥ 32 MB)
Result: The CPU writes the service data file DUMP.S7S to the SIMATIC memory card and
remains in STOP mode.
The transfer of the service data has been completed as soon as the STOP LED stops
flashing and lights up continuously. If the transfer was successful, only the STOP LED lights
up. If the transfer was not successful, the STOP LED lights up and the ERROR LED flashes.
In case of an error, the CPU stores a text file with a note on the error that occurred in the
DUMP.S7S folder.
Use the SIMATIC memory card to read out the service data only if you are no longer able to
communicate with the CPU via Ethernet. In all other cases it is preferable to read out the
service data via the Web server or STEP 7.
